Creating a
SKILL.mdfordbcDirectory Structure
Create a skill directory at the root of your repo or in a dedicated location:
dbc/ └── SKILL.mdThe directory name must match the
namefield in frontmatter, so usedbcfor both.Key Requirements from the Spec
-
Frontmatter (required):
name: lowercase, hyphens only, max 64 chars, must match directory namedescription: max 1024 chars, describe what it does and when to use it
-
Body content: Step-by-step instructions, examples, edge cases
-
Keep it concise: Under 500 lines recommended for the main file; use
references/for detailed docs
Recommended SKILL.md Content
--- name: dbc description: Install and manage ADBC (Arrow Database Connectivity) drivers. Use when the user needs to install database drivers for Snowflake, PostgreSQL, BigQuery, DuckDB, or other ADBC-supported databases, or when managing driver dependencies in a project. license: Apache-2.0 compatibility: Requires dbc CLI to be installed. Works on macOS, Linux, and Windows. metadata: author: columnar version: "1.0" --- # dbc - ADBC Driver Manager Install and manage ADBC database drivers. ## Quick Commands - `dbc install <driver>` - Install a driver (e.g., `dbc install snowflake`) - `dbc search [pattern]` - Search available drivers - `dbc info <driver>` - Get driver details ## Project Workflow For reproducible driver management in a project: 1. `dbc init` - Create a `dbc.toml` file 2. `dbc add <driver>` - Add drivers to the list (supports version constraints like `dbc add "postgresql>=13.0"`) 3. `dbc sync` - Install all drivers and create `dbc.lock` ## Using Installed Drivers After installation, use drivers via Python's adbc-driver-manager: ```python import adbc_driver_manager.dbapi as adbc with adbc.connect(driver="snowflake", db_kwargs={...}) as con: cursor = con.cursor() cursor.execute("SELECT * FROM table") table = cursor.fetch_arrow_table()
Common Drivers
snowflake- Snowflake Data Cloudpostgresql- PostgreSQLbigquery- Google BigQueryduckdb- DuckDBflightsql- Arrow Flight SQLsqlite- SQLite
Additional Commands
dbc uninstall <driver>- Remove a driverdbc remove <driver>- Remove from dbc.tomldbc docs <driver>- Open driver documentationdbc auth login- Authenticate with private registries
Where to Place It
You have two options:
- In your repo root: Create a
dbc/SKILL.mddirectory/file at the repo root - Separate distribution: Publish to a skill registry or include in your installation artifacts
Optional Enhancements
If you want to provide more detailed reference material without bloating the main file:
dbc/ ├── SKILL.md └── references/ └── REFERENCE.md # Detailed command reference, all flags, etc. -

How Skill Discovery Works
According to the spec, there are two approaches:
-
Filesystem-based agents (like Claude Code): Skills are discovered by scanning "configured directories" for folders
containingSKILL.md. The agent loads metadata at startup and injects it into context. -
Tool-based agents: Implement custom tools for skill activation.
The Gap: No Standard Location
The spec does not define a standard directory where skills should be installed. It's left to each agent
implementation to decide where to look. This means:- There's no universal registry
- There's no standard
~/.skills/or/usr/share/skills/path defined - Each agent (Claude Code, Cursor, etc.) may have its own convention
Options for
dbcOption 1: Document manual placement
Tell users to copy the skill to wherever their agent looks. For Claude Code, this might be a project's
.claude/skills/
or~/.claude/skills/directory (though I'd need to verify Claude Code's specific convention).Option 2: Add a
dbc skillsubcommanddbc skill install --agent claude-code # Installs to ~/.claude/skills/dbc/ dbc skill install --path ./my-skills/ # Installs to custom path dbc skill show # Prints the SKILL.md content
Option 3: Bundle in installation artifacts
Include the
dbc/SKILL.mddirectory in your distributed packages and document where it ends up.Option 4: Publish to a registry (future)
The spec mentions a
skills-refreference implementation. A centralized registry may emerge.My Recommendation
For now, I'd suggest:
- Include the SKILL.md in your repo at
skills/dbc/SKILL.md - Add a simple command like
dbc skillthat prints the path or content, so users can easily copy it - Document how users should configure their specific agent to find it
